Pope Leo XIV, the first American pope, visited Lampedusa island on July 4 and prayed at a migrant cemetery and the Door of Europe memorial. During Mass he called for Europe to develop a long-term plan covering reception, protection, support, and integration of migrants while supporting development in countries of origin. The visit occurred on the 250th anniversary of U.S. independence at a primary Mediterranean arrival point for North African crossings.
